GB/T 17985.1-2000
ActiveTurning tools with carbide tips--Part1:Designation and marking
硬质合金车刀 第1部分:代号及标志
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ies the designation system and marking requirements for carbide-tipped turning tools used in metal cutting operations. It is applied in manufacturing industries, particularly for lathe tool selection, inventory management, and procurement, ensuring consistent identification of tool geometry and carbide grade across production and quality control contexts.
